Line installers play an important function in the commercial, industrial and domestic fields. As the name suggests, these electrical contractors function outdoors on electrical power line transmissions, communication cords, and fiber optics - electrical company. They are accountable for guaranteeing that the electrical wiring is properly functioning.
While setting up and repairing electrical wires is both physically requiring and dangerous, companies frequently provide greater pay to make up for their job. The BLS recommends that line installers and repairers earn an annual typical salary of about $68,030. Inside wiremen service low-voltage electrical contractors and household, industrial, and commercial systems.
They can likewise aid evaluate and maintain electrical motors or install fire alarm system systems or electrical control panels. Inside electrician typically have to function complete time, consisting of on weekend breaks, as electrical failings and emergency situations might emerge any time.

Electrical experts should complete certain on-the-job training components in solar photovoltaic or pv systems to pursue entry-level tasks as solar installers. These training programs can last anywhere from one month to one year. Some solar PV system makers additionally carry out training on their details products. PV installers in some cases have a senior high school diploma.

A lot of electrician training programs call for a high-school diploma or GED. Consequently, first, you must concentrate on conference your education demands. As soon as you obtain your high-school diploma, you can enlist in an electrical expert apprenticeship program. You'll obtain concept directions and extensive on-the-job useful work during your training. However, these programs take a very long time to complete.

A lot of apprenticeships consist of at the very least 144 hours of classwork and a minimum of 2,000 hours of on-the-job training. Different components of the nation offer various demands to come to be an electrician. In the majority of states, licensing is needed. Generally, a monitored apprenticeship is needed to get approved for the licensure exam. Most U.S. states need electricians to obtain a certificate before they begin working.
